Strengths-Based Leadership: Great Leaders, Teams, and Why People Follow Them: by Tom Rath and Barry Conchie.
Strengths-based leadership is a management style focused on recognizing and leveraging individual strengths to achieve organizational goals. It emphasizes the positive aspects of employees.
Successful leaders use three strategies: 1) know your strengths and invest in your team’s strengths, 2) get the right people with the right strengths on your team, and 3) understand the basic needs of your team.
